disciplinesurveying is a method used to gather information about the subject matter expertise or knowledge areas of individuals within an organization or a specific group. It aims to identify who possesses what skills, making it easier to allocate resources, form teams, or understand the overall capability landscape. This process can involve various data collection techniques, such as questionnaires, interviews, or self-assessments.
